Login AuthZ
Name
Secondary Method
Configure the authorization method and secondary authorization method for login
users by using one of the following options:
• HWTACACS—HWTACACS authorization. You must specify the HWTACACS
scheme to be used.
• Local—Local authorization.
• None—This method trusts all users and assigns default rights to them.
• RADIUS—RADIUS authorization. You must specify the RADIUS scheme to be used.
• Not Set—The device uses the settings in the Default AuthZ area for login users.

Command AuthZ
Name
Configure the command authorization method by using one of the following options:
• HWTACACS—HWTACACS authorization. You must specify the HWTACACS
scheme to be used.
• Not Set—The device uses the settings in the Default AuthZ area for command
authorization.
